Herb Braised Carrots

Here are the ingredients you will need to prepare this wonderful dish:

  • 1 pound of fresh carrots, peeled and cut into 1-inch pieces
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• 2 tablespoons butter
  • 2 garlic cloves, minced
  • 1 teaspoon fresh thyme leaves (or 1/2 teaspoon dried thyme)
  • 1 teaspoon fresh rosemary, chopped (or 1/2 teaspoon dried rosemary)
  • Salt and pepper to taste
  • 1/4 cup vegetable or chicken broth
  • 1 tablespoon honey (optional)

Now let’s get into the cooking instructions:

  1. Begin by heating the olive oil and butter in a large skillet over medium heat. Once the butter has melted, add the minced garlic and sauté for about 1 minute until fragrant.
  2. Add the chopped carrots to the skillet. Sprinkle with thyme, rosemary, salt, and pepper. Stir to combine the ingredients well.
  3. Pour in the vegetable or chicken broth, and if desired, drizzle the honey over the carrots. This will add a touch of sweetness to balance the savory herbs.
  4. Bring the mixture to a gentle simmer, then cover the skillet and let it cook for 15-20 minutes, or until the carrots are tender and easily pierced with a fork.
  5. Once done, remove the lid and allow the dish to simmer for an additional 5 minutes to reduce the liquid slightly. Adjust seasoning if necessary.
  6. Serve the herb braised carrots warm, garnished with additional fresh herbs if you’re feeling fancy!
